Handover: Brightmoor DNS flakiness. Resolution to the Ashfell metrics cluster fails intermittently — roughly 1 in 200 lookups times out, then retries succeed. Suspect the stub resolver cache on the edge nodes; packet captures are on the shared drive. No fix yet, mitigation is the raised retry count. Release manager should hold the 2.9 rollout. Current resolver settings for the affected service are below.

config for bagep-kageg:
ULADOR_LOG_LEVEL=warn
ULADOR_METRICS_HOST=metrics.ulador.tolvaqcorp.corp
ULADOR_POOL_SIZE=32

// FD_LEAK_WATCH_THRESHOLD — Gristmill daemon
//
// Support: if open descriptors on a Gristmill worker cross this
// threshold, the leak hunter dumps handle owners and restarts the
// worker. Don't raise it to silence pages; file a ticket instead.
// The build that introduced the watcher is identified by the token
// below.

pipeline stamp: htk21_86b657ac0aa916a9af17f

Quick note for the sync: Pebbleforge now hot-reloads config via the watcher sidecar — no more rolling restarts for flag flips. Heads up: the watcher debounces changes for 10s, so don't panic if a toggle looks ignored. If a reload fails validation, the old config stays live and an event fires. Rollback steps, known gotchas, and the validation schema all live on this page.

runbook for badug-kadup: https://confluence.zemvarlabs.internal/projects/browse/display/projects/bd1b

Quick intro to `memscope`, our GPU memory profiler, since it comes up a lot in sync. It wraps allocator hooks around training jobs on the Cindervale cluster and dumps per-kernel allocation timelines you can open in the viewer. Start with the `--coarse` flag — full tracing adds real overhead and will slow your job noticeably. Most OOMs we've chased turned out to be fragmentation, not leaks, so check the fragmentation panel first. For access requests or weird traces, ping the tooling folks at the address below.

escalation mailbox, bafog-fafog: ulador@paliqlabs.internal